[Midazolam as a premedicant for trigeminal nerve blocks]
H Iida1, M Takenaka, T Tanahashi
1Department of Anesthesiology, Gifu University School of Medicine.
Summary
Midazolam effectively reduces discomfort and recall during painful trigeminal nerve blocks. This study found the 0.1 mg.kg-1 dose safe and beneficial for patients undergoing nerve blocks.

Background:
- Trigeminal neuralgia treatment often involves nerve blocks, which can be painful and uncomfortable for patients.
- Effective pain management and patient comfort are crucial during invasive procedures.
Purpose of the Study:
- To evaluate the efficacy and safety of midazolam as a premedicant for trigeminal nerve blocks.
- To determine the optimal dosage of midazolam for reducing procedural discomfort and recall.
Main Methods:
- A randomized controlled trial involving 19 patients undergoing trigeminal nerve blocks.
- Patients received midazolam (0.05 mg.kg-1 or 0.1 mg.kg-1) or a saline placebo prior to the procedure.
- Patient recall and discomfort levels were assessed the following day.
Main Results:
- The group receiving 0.1 mg.kg-1 midazolam reported significantly less discomfort and procedural recall.
- No serious adverse effects were observed in patients administered midazolam.
- Midazolam demonstrated a favorable safety profile at the tested dosages.
Conclusions:
- Midazolam is a safe and effective premedicant for trigeminal nerve blocks.
- The 0.1 mg.kg-1 dosage of midazolam significantly improves patient experience during the procedure.
- Premedication with midazolam can enhance patient comfort and reduce anxiety during uncomfortable medical interventions.
